Visit during the early morning or late afternoon for the best chances to see flamingos and enjoy cooler temperatures.
Bring essentials like water, snacks, and sun protection, as amenities on the island may be limited.
Wear comfortable shoes suitable for walking on sand.

Greater Flamingo Island, also known as Ras R'mal, is a peninsula located north of Djerba Island. It's a highly visited destination, attracting tourists with its pristine beach and clear, turquoise waters. The island is an eco-reserve where thousands of flamingos gather, creating a breathtaking spectacle of neon-pink against the azure sea. These elegant birds frequent the island particularly during the winter months (November to March) as a resting and breeding ground. The island offers a mix of experiences, from tranquil relaxation to engaging activities. Visitors can stroll along the beaches, swim in the inviting waters, and explore the unique ecosystems. Boat trips to the island often include entertainment, traditional Tunisian cuisine, and opportunities to spot dolphins. Despite its popularity, Greater Flamingo Island retains its natural charm, offering a serene escape and a chance to appreciate Tunisia's beautiful wildlife. The island is accessible only by boat, with tours departing regularly from Djerba.

    Getting There

    Boat

    The primary way to reach Greater Flamingo Island is by boat from Houmt Souk. Head to the marina (Port de Houmt Souk) and look for boat tours heading to the island. These tours often include lunch and entertainment. The boat ride typically takes about an hour. Expect to pay around 20-37 euros for a boat trip, which often includes lunch.
